Opcom:

Theoretically interested but not anywhere near ready. Never have used AM on 2M before and have only one transmitter that could do it.

This little BC-640 guy here will make a 50W carrier with a pair of VT-204/HK-24s and uses 811As in the plate modulator and covers 100 to 156MHz according to the book. A modern DDS would work in lieu of an 8 to 8.1111 MHz crystal. It's 601 LBs, so maybe a contender for the heavy metal award at 12 Lb per Watt.

Need to rebuild one of the power supplies (therefore the gap)

I'm in Dallas and too far away under usual circumstances. but there is a discone or two in the garage and a 50FT tower in the back yard with a lonely dipole on it.

It would certainly cheeze off all the FM and SSB folks on the band around here. Is there a customary 'AM' area on 2M or just pick an empty phone frequency away from repeaters and fire up? Lots of repeaters in the area but not so many that there'd be no room.
